Karonda season is Spring, Summer and Fall and English Lavender season is Spring, Summer and Fall. The type of soil for Karonda is Loam and for English Lavender is Loam, Sand while the PH of soil for Karonda is Acidic, Neutral, Alkaline and for English Lavender is Neutral, Alkaline.
Karonda and English Lavender physical information is very important for comparison. Karonda height is 120.00 cm and width 120.00 cm whereas English Lavender height is 30.00 cm and width 60.00 cm. The color specification of Karonda and English Lavender are as follows:
Karonda flower color: Pale White and White
Karonda leaf color: Green
English Lavender flower color: White, Purple, Lavender and Blue Violet
Care of Karonda and English Lavender include pruning, fertilizers, watering etc. Karonda pruning is done Prune if you want to improve plant shape and Remove dead leaves and English Lavender pruning is done Prune in late summer or fall, Prune twice a year, Remove damaged leaves and Remove hanging branches. In summer Karonda need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Average Water. Whereas, in summer English Lavender needs Ample Water and in winter, it needs Less Watering.
